数据库服务器有哪些功能,数据库服务器的种类与功能解析,构建高效数据管理平台的关键要素
- 综合资讯
- 2024-10-30 02:17:16
- 0
数据库服务器具备存储、管理、查询、维护数据等功能。不同种类的数据库服务器如关系型、NoSQL等各有其特点和适用场景。构建高效数据管理平台需关注数据存储、安全、性能、可扩...
数据库服务器具备存储、管理、查询、维护数据等功能。不同种类的数据库服务器如关系型、NoSQL等各有其特点和适用场景。构建高效数据管理平台需关注数据存储、安全、性能、可扩展性等关键要素。
随着信息化时代的到来,数据库服务器已成为各类企业、机构和个人不可或缺的数据管理平台,数据库服务器不仅能够存储和管理大量数据,还能提供高效、稳定的数据查询和操作能力,本文将详细介绍数据库服务器的种类与功能,帮助读者全面了解这一关键要素。
数据库服务器的种类
1、关系型数据库服务器
关系型数据库服务器(RDBMS)是最常见的数据库服务器类型,以关系模型为基础,通过表格存储数据,代表产品有Oracle、MySQL、SQL Server、PostgreSQL等。
2、非关系型数据库服务器
非关系型数据库服务器(NoSQL)在近年来得到了快速发展,适用于处理大规模、高并发的数据场景,主要分为以下几类:
(1)文档型数据库:如MongoDB、CouchDB等,以文档的形式存储数据。
(2)键值型数据库:如Redis、Memcached等,以键值对的形式存储数据。
(3)列存储数据库:如HBase、Cassandra等,以列的形式存储数据。
(4)图数据库:如Neo4j、OrientDB等,以图的形式存储数据。
3、分布式数据库服务器
分布式数据库服务器将数据分散存储在多个节点上,通过分布式计算实现数据的高可用性和高性能,代表产品有Hadoop、Spark等。
数据库服务器的功能
1、数据存储与管理
数据库服务器负责存储和管理各类数据,包括结构化数据、半结构化数据和非结构化数据,通过表格、文档、键值对等形式,将数据有序地组织起来,方便用户进行查询、修改和删除操作。
2、数据查询与操作
数据库服务器提供丰富的查询语言和操作接口,如SQL、NoSQL查询语言等,用户可以根据需求进行数据查询、更新、插入和删除等操作。
3、数据安全与权限管理
数据库服务器具备完善的数据安全机制,包括用户认证、访问控制、数据加密等,通过权限管理,确保数据的安全性,防止未经授权的访问和篡改。
4、数据备份与恢复
数据库服务器支持数据备份和恢复功能,确保数据在发生意外情况时能够及时恢复,常见的备份方式有全备份、增量备份和差异备份等。
5、数据高可用性与容错性
数据库服务器具备高可用性和容错性,通过数据复制、负载均衡等技术,确保系统在面临故障时能够快速恢复,保证数据服务的连续性。
6、数据分区与分布式处理
数据库服务器支持数据分区和分布式处理,将数据分散存储在多个节点上,提高数据处理能力和扩展性,通过分布式计算,实现大规模数据的快速处理。
7、数据集成与数据交换
数据库服务器支持与其他系统进行数据集成和交换,如与业务系统、数据仓库等进行数据同步,实现数据共享和业务协同。
8、数据分析与挖掘
数据库服务器具备数据分析与挖掘功能,支持数据挖掘、数据挖掘算法、数据可视化等,帮助用户从海量数据中挖掘有价值的信息。
数据库服务器作为数据管理平台的核心,其种类和功能丰富多样,了解数据库服务器的种类与功能,有助于构建高效、稳定、安全的数据管理平台,在选择数据库服务器时,应根据实际需求、业务场景和技术能力进行合理选择。
本文链接:https://www.zhitaoyun.cn/428558.html
发表评论